Burger King® Scholars Program
Scholarship Eligibility
Application period opens Nov. 15, 2011 and closes Jan. 10, 2012 Click here to apply now.
Applicants must meet all of the following criteria:
BURGER KING® General Track (Note: Employees and children of employees who meet eligibility requirements for both tracks will be considered for an award in both tracks, but if selected, will receive only one award)
- Be residents of the United States, Canada or Puerto Rico
- Be graduating high school seniors (U.S. and Puerto Rico), graduating from grade 12 (Canada) or graduating from home school education in the U.S., Puerto Rico or Canada
- Have a cumulative high school grade point average of 2.5 or higher on a 4.0 scale, or the equivalent
- Plan to enroll full-time, without interruption, for the entire 2012-13 academic year at an accredited two- or four-year college, university, or vocational-technical school in the U.S., Canada or Puerto Rico
BURGER KING® Employee-Based Track (Note: Employee track will have two components as follows)
- Be residents of the United States, Canada or Puerto Rico
